Pasta e Fagioli Soup is a classic Italian dish with a name that literally translates to “pasta and beans”. It is a beloved rustic Italian soup that embodies simple ingredients and immense flavor. A staple for generations, this heartwarming dish offers a balance of protein, fiber, complex carbohydrates, and an abundance of nutrients – perfect for fueling your body and satisfying your soul. My rendition is packed with fresh vegetables, tender beans, and perfectly cooked pasta in a savory broth – a guilt-free indulgence that supports your health and dietary goals.
Hearty & Healthy Pasta e Fagioli Soup
🍲 Craving cozy? This Pasta e Fagioli Soup is here for you! 😋 Packed with protein, fiber & flavor!
Ingredients
- 2 tablespoons olive oil
- 1 medium onion, chopped
- 2 carrots, chopped
- 2 celery stalks, chopped
- 4 cloves garlic, minced
- 1 teaspoon dried Italian seasoning
- 1/2 teaspoon red pepper flakes (optional)
- 1 (28-ounce) can crushed tomatoes
- 4 cups vegetable broth
- 1 (15-ounce) can cannellini beans, drained and rinsed
- 1 (15-ounce) can kidney beans, drained and rinsed
- 1/2 cup ditalini pasta (or other small pasta shape)
- Salt and black pepper to taste
- Freshly grated Parmesan cheese for serving (optional)
- Freshly chopped parsley for serving (optional)
Instructions
- Heat olive oil in a large pot or Dutch oven over medium heat. Add onion, carrots, and celery and cook, stirring occasionally, until softened, about 5-7 minutes.
- Add garlic, Italian seasoning, and red pepper flakes (if using) and cook for 1 minute more, stirring constantly.
- Pour in the crushed tomatoes, vegetable broth, cannellini beans, and kidney beans. Bring to a simmer, then reduce heat and simmer for 20 minutes, or until the vegetables are tender.
- Stir in the pasta and cook according to package directions, or until al dente.
- Season to taste with salt and black pepper. Serve hot with a sprinkle of Parmesan cheese and fresh parsley, if desired.
Nutrition Information:
Yield:
6Serving Size:
1Amount Per Serving: Calories: 250Total Fat: 7gSaturated Fat: 1gCholesterol: 0mgSodium: 500mgCarbohydrates: 38gSugar: 5gProtein: 12g
Some Products You May Like
No products found.
Cultural Background and Significance
Pasta e Fagioli holds a cherished place in Italian cuisine, originating as a peasant dish utilizing simple, affordable ingredients. Traditionally, families would make use of leftover pasta and beans to create this resourceful, nourishing soup. It stands as a testament to Italian ingenuity and the celebration of humble ingredients.
Health Benefits of Pasta e Fagioli Soup
- Excellent source of protein and fiber
The combination of beans and pasta provides ample protein and fiber, promoting satiety, aiding digestion, and helping manage blood sugar levels. - Rich in vitamins and minerals
The vegetables and beans offer vitamins A, C, K, folate, iron, potassium, and magnesium, essential for various bodily functions. - Supports heart health
The fiber content helps lower cholesterol, while the potassium in the beans contributes to blood pressure regulation – both important factors in cardiovascular health. - Naturally low in fat
This is a satisfying meal that won’t overload you with unhealthy fats. - Adaptable to dietary needs
Easily made vegan by omitting Parmesan cheese and gluten-free by using gluten-free pasta.
Tips for a Perfect Cook
- Aromatics are key
Don’t skip the onion, carrot, celery, and garlic – they form the flavor foundation of this soup. - Taste as you go
Adjust salt, pepper, and Italian seasoning throughout the cooking process for the best flavor balance. - Don’t overcook the pasta
Add the pasta towards the end to ensure it’s al dente – it will continue to cook slightly in the hot broth. - Garnish for freshness
Finish with Parmesan cheese (if desired) and fresh parsley for a touch of brightness.
Variations and Modifications
- Spice it up
Add a pinch of chili powder or cayenne pepper for extra heat. - Greens boost
Stir in chopped spinach or kale at the end of cooking for additional nutrients. - Protein variation
Substitute some beans with cooked ground beef, sausage, or pancetta for a meaty version. - Fresh herbs
Experiment with rosemary, thyme, or basil for a different flavor profile.
Common Mistakes to Avoid
- Underseasoning
Don’t be afraid to season generously with salt and pepper. - Overcooking the vegetables
Make sure the vegetables are softened but not mushy. - Boiling the pasta separately
Cooking the pasta directly in the soup adds flavor and thickens the broth slightly. - Forgetting the garnishes
A sprinkle of Parmesan and fresh herbs make a big difference.
Frequently Asked Questions
-
Can I use dried beans?
Yes. Soak them overnight and cook them according to package instructions before adding them to the soup.
-
Can I make this soup in a slow cooker?
Absolutely! Sauté the vegetables, then add everything except the pasta to the slow cooker and cook on low for 6-8 hours or high for 3-4 hours. Add the pasta during the last 30 minutes of cooking.
-
How do I store leftovers?
Store leftovers in an airtight container in the refrigerator for up to 4 days.
-
Can I freeze Pasta e Fagioli?
Yes, but freeze without the pasta. Cook the pasta fresh when reheating.
-
What other types of pasta can I use?
Any small pasta shape like elbow macaroni, rotini, or shells will work.
-
Is this soup gluten-free?
To keep this soup gluten-free, choose gluten-free pasta.
-
My soup is too thick. How can I thin it?
Add a splash of extra broth or water.
-
My soup is too thin. How can I thicken it?
Simmer for a few more minutes uncovered to reduce the liquid slightly.
-
How can I make this soup vegan?
Skip the Parmesan cheese garnish or use a vegan Parmesan alternative.
-
What can I serve with Pasta e Fagioli?
A crusty bread for dipping and a simple green salad.
Conclusion
This wholesome and comforting Pasta e Fagioli Soup is a classic for a reason. Easy to make, incredibly versatile, and deeply satisfying, it’s a recipe that deserves a permanent spot in your meal rotation. Try it tonight and experience the true essence of Italian comfort food – with a healthy twist!